Va. man nabbed in Craigslist sex sting; drawn in by fake ad:

Claude Philip Diehl Jr., of Hollywood, Virginia was arrested for allegedly trying to trade beer and cash for having sex with a 13-year-old girl. Diehl allegedly responded to an ad on craigslist that read in part “Leftover Halloween candy? “Anyone have candy to donate to ‘girl’ so she’s not sad anymore?” The ad was in the casual encounters section. You know, one of the many un-moderated sections of craigslist.

Diehl allegedly worked for a beer distributor and promised the father who was pimping out his daughter $40 and 5 cases of beer. He showed up for the tryst with the beer and the cash, condoms and a Miley Cyrus CD. Luckily when the beer was placed in the father’s truck it turns out the father was part of the Leesburg, Virginia police force and promptly arrested Diehl.

Luckily this was all a sting operation and there was no 13-year-old girl however it shows a couple of things. First, while this ad was a fake it shows that there are people out there whoring out their kids on craigslist. The second thing is that if craigslist’s user policing works as well as they claim this ad should have never seen the light of day. And Lastly Jim Buckmaster can’t claim that this has happened in newspaper advertisements. I don’t think any self respecting newspaper would have ever run an ad like that.

Tea couple accused of sex trafficking involving underage girls:

Brandon Quincy Thompson, 26, and his girlfriend Megan Marie Hayes, 30, of Tea, South Dakota have been federally charged with pimping out underage girls on backpage. Thompson and Hayes are both looking at life sentences.

For once a media outlet is finally calling backpage to task and backpage is acting familiar…

We contacted the BackPage Web site by email as to why such ads were being allowed on the site since they appeared to violate the terms of agreement. We have received no answer from the company.

Cleveland robber who used Craigslist to lure a victim gets 12 years in prison:

34-year-old Shawn Williams of Cleveland, Ohio was sentenced to 12 years behind bars for a pair of robberies he was convicted for.

The one we’re concerned about was the one where Williams posted an ad on craigslist for a large screen TV, a Playstation and some games for $1000.

When a buyer met up with Williams he robbed him at gunpoint.

Police Investigate Craigslist Sex Post:

Police in Sacramento, California are investigating the following ad they allegedly found on craigslist…

Hi. “I’m 12 and I need sexual help. I wanna be experienced when I get to high school. Don’t email me. Just call…”

The number itself traced back to a prepaid cell phone.

Police do not think that it is an actual 12-year-old girl but some kind of sexual predator. Unfortunately their hands are tied with what they can do since this isn’t a life or death situation.

Man, estranged wife charged with filming themselves raping girl, 4:

Friend of the site Dodia Fae sent in this tip to be considered under the News of Doom section of the site. It certainly does meet the requirements for that but I did a little digging and found that the story has a craigslist connection. But I’m getting a little ahead of myself.

Our story starts with 38-year-old Richard Hockaday of San Diego. He’s a sex offender who posed as a single mother on craigslist looking for others to have some sort of ‘fantasy’ in either San Diego or the Seattle area. Hockaday is accused of sexually abusing a boy he was mentoring between 2003 and 2007.

Through craigslist Hockaday was able to meet Brian Beston, 36, and Hollie Beston, 31, of Burien, Washington. Allegedly the 360 lb Brian Beston (pictured) would have sex with a 4-year-old girl while filmed by Hollie Beston in exchange for other child porn images from Hockaday.

Both Bestons have pleaded not guilty.
